New best street tires Buick GN
16' GNX style rims with Sumitomo 245's
60 2.0
1/8 et 8.0
1/8 90
1/4 et 12.45
1/4 110
Through the exhaust with 20 psi boost on alcohol. (93 octane in tank)
ta 49 turbo, ported tb, bigger down pipe and exhaust, 3000 stall converter.

I have an SMC single nozzle kit. The most boost I've ran is 24 with it but only in short bursts. At my power level (335 horse) in the 1/4 I am just about tapped out with the single nozzle kit. Maybe with a bigger jet or dual nozzle it could support more power. To tell you the truth in the future I'll be porting my heads and perhaps going roller at that point I'll dump the alky and run 16 psi. And make more power than at my current 20psi.

Yes, porting the heads will make a big difference. But don't back down the boost or you'll not take advantage of the heads. I'm running 25 psi w/ a single Alkycontrol kit, champion ported irons, t63e turbo to the tune of 10.70 @ 128. Lots of boost is where it at with these cars....
